Zytax Announces General Availability of ZMS Compliance 5. Major Release of Fuel Tax Automation Software Now Includes SaaS Option



Zytax, a wholly-owned subsidiary of FuelQuest and leading supplier of indirect tax automation software, announced today the general availability of Zytax ZMS Compliance 5. This major release of its flagship product automates the end-to-end motor fuels tax filing process for large and small filers and is now available as a Software as a Service (SaaS). With ZMS Compliance 5, customers can gain greater tax filing consistency and reliability while reducing processing costs and risks.

Zytax ZMS Compliance 5 automates transactional import, schedule and return generation, and multi-format filing including EDI, XML, Excel, and paper. Zytax also provides automated updates of the constantly changing rates, rules, and forms for all major jurisdictions, driving greater filing accuracy. Key new features include:

Software as a Service - Enables secure, web-based filing of motor fuels excise taxes with minimal IT investment

Enhanced Troubleshooting - Simplifies identification and update of schedule transaction, return, and filing errors with context sensitive help

Dynamic Workflows - Enables customizable workflow automation for business processes associated with fuel tax filing including review, approval, and event notification

Common Platform - Provides a single repository for rates, forms, and rules across all Zytax products and delivers enhanced security, performance, multi-user support, and audit logging.

About Zytax

Zytax, a wholly owned subsidiary of FuelQuest, Inc., supplies strategic software automation solutions for global indirect tax determination and excise motor fuel compliance for the energy industry. Zytax solutions provide complete visibility across the tax organization increasing the ability to track, forecast and report tax obligations while mitigating risk and reducing fines, fees, and penalties. Headquartered in Houston, Texas, Zytax has served the energy industry for more than 14 years, providing excise and specialty tax solutions for more than 700 installed customers.
